Benefits and Drawbacks of Using Epoxy over Ground Concrete
Epoxy flooring has become immense popularity in recent years due to its durability, aesthetic appeal, and ease of maintenance. However, before deciding to apply epoxy over ground concrete, it's crucial to analyze the implications. On the positive side, epoxy delivers a smooth, uniform surface that is resistant to scratches, stains, and chemicals. It also improves the overall appearance of the floor and can be customized with diverse colors and textures. On the other hand, epoxy installation can be a involved process that requires expert labor. The material itself can also be pricey, and proper surface preparation is essential for a successful outcome. Furthermore, epoxy flooring can be susceptible to damage from severe blows, and repairs may require expertise.

Applying Concrete for Epoxy Installation
When it comes to achieving a durable and attractive epoxy coating on your concrete surface, preparation is key. Begin by thoroughly cleaning the substrate with a pressure washer or a stiff brush and solvent. This will eliminate any loose debris, dirt, oil, or grease that could interfere proper bonding. Next, examine the concrete for any cracks or issues and repair them with a suitable concrete patching product. Allow the patch to cure completely according to the manufacturer's instructions before proceeding.
After the concrete is clean and repaired, you'll need to grind the surface to create a better bond for the epoxy. This can be achieved using a concrete grinder or a diamond disk. Remember to wear appropriate safety protection during this step. Finally, apply a bonding agent specifically designed for epoxy coatings. Allow the primer to dry completely before putting on the epoxy coating.
Achieving Expert Results with Epoxy Flooring Installation Tips |
Preparing your concrete surface for epoxy is vital. Employ a quality concrete polisher to refine the surface, removing any flaws. A fine tungsten carbide pad will yield optimal outcomes. Once ground, thoroughly vacuum the floor to eliminate all debris.
- Seal your concrete with an epoxy bonding agent according to producer's recommendations. This ensures proper attachment of the epoxy coating.
- Mix your epoxy component and hardener according to the supplier's recommendations. Precise ratio is critical for achieving a long-lasting finish.
- Pour the epoxy mixture evenly across your prepared floor using a squeegee. Operate in small sections, overlapping each section to eliminate stripes.
- Dry time for epoxy can vary depending on the product used and environmental circumstances. Adhere to the producer's recommendations for proper drying time.
